    What are VOCs?

    VOC is the abbreviation for Volatile Organic Compounds. In general terms, VOC refers to organic compounds that are volatile. From an environmental perspective, VOC specifically refers to reactive volatile organic compounds that may cause harm to human health and the environment. Common VOCs include benzene, toluene, xylene, ethylbenzene, styrene, formaldehyde, TVOC (total volatile organic compounds, typically C6–C16 alkanes), ketones and others. Common VOCs include benzene, toluene, xylene, ethylbenzene, styrene, formaldehyde, TVOC (total volatile organic compounds, typically C6–C16 alkanes), ketones and others.

    The most common classification method currently used for VOCs is based on boiling point, as shown in the table below.

     

    Boiling Point

    Name

    Examples of VOCs and Boiling Points

    Boiling point < 50 °C

    Very Volatile Organic Compounds (VVOC)

    Methane (-161 °C), formaldehyde (-21 °C), methyl mercaptan (6 °C), acetaldehyde (20 °C), dichloromethane (40 °C)

    50 °C ≤ Boiling point < 260 °C

    Volatile Organic Compounds (VOC)

    Ethyl acetate (77 °C), ethanol (78 °C), benzene (80 °C), methyl ethyl ketone (80 °C), toluene (110 °C), trichloroethane (113 °C), xylene (140 °C), limonene (178 °C), nicotine (247 °C)

    260 °C ≤ Boiling point < 400 °C

    Semi-Volatile Organic Compounds (SVOC)

    Chlorpyrifos (290 °C), dibutyl phthalate (340 °C), di(2-ethylhexyl) phthalate (390 °C)

     

    VOC Regulations and Requirements in Different Countries and Regions

    European Union

    (EU) No. 305/2011 Construction Products Regulation (CPR)

    2004/42/EC Directive on the limitation of emissions of volatile organic compounds (VOCs) due to the use of organic solvents in certain paints and varnishes and vehicle refinishing products (amending Directive 1999/13/EC)

     

     

    France

    Mandatory VOC Emission Labeling for Interior Building Materials

    Decree No. 2011-321 Relating to the Labeling of Construction Products, Floor or Wall Coverings, Paints and Varnishes with Respect to Their Emission of Volatile Pollutants

     

     

     

     

    Germany

    Ü Mark Certification

    AgBB/DIBt–German VOC limits

    AgBB = German Committee for Health-related Evaluation of Building Products. According to German low-VOC requirements for construction products, products are classified as either compliant or non-compliant, without emission level categories. Approval is conducted by the German Institute for Building Technology (DIBt).

    GEV EMICODE Certification

     

     

     

     

    Belgium

    Belgian VOC Regulations

    Royal Decree C–2014/24239

     

     

    United States

    CARB (SCAQMD)

    BIFMA 7.1

     

    China

    GB 18582 Limit of Harmful Substances of Interior Wall Coatings for Interior Decoration and Renovation Materials

    GB 24408 Limit of Harmful Substances of Exterior Wall Coatings for Buildings

    GB/T 1725 Paints, Varnishes and Plastics — Determination of Non-Volatile Matter Content

    GB/T 23984 Paints and Varnishes — Determination of Volatile Organic Compound (VOC) Content of Low-VOC Emulsion Paints (In-can VOC)

    GB/T 23985 Paints and Varnishes — Determination of Volatile Organic Compound (VOC) Content — Difference Method

    GB/T 23986 Paints and Varnishes — Determination of Volatile Organic Compound (VOC) Content — Gas Chromatographic Method

    JC 1066 Limit of Harmful Substances in Building Waterproof Coatings
